آموزش کار با داده های از راه دور در Xamarin.Forms برنامه های کاربردی

Working with Remote Data in Xamarin.Forms Applications

ن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یویی برای نمایش وجود ندارد.
توضیحات دوره: بیاموزید که چگونه برنامه Xamarin.Forms شما برای نیازهای داده خود با API ارتباط برقرار می کند. با استفاده از Xamarin.Forms ، توسعه دهندگان .NET توانایی ایجاد برنامه های موبایل را با سهولت دارند. تقریباً هر برنامه ای نیاز به برقراری ارتباط با یک باطن برای داده ها دارد. در این دوره ، کار با Remote Data in Xamarin.Forms Applications ، خواهید آموخت که چگونه می توانید از طریق برنامه های Xamarin.Forms خود به داده های از راه دور از طریق سرویس ها دسترسی پیدا کنید. ابتدا ، انواع مختلف خدمات پشتیبانی شده را خواهید دید ، زیرا Xamarin.Forms نمی تواند فقط با هر نوع سرویس ارتباط برقرار کند. در مرحله بعدی ، شما نحوه برقراری ارتباط با خدمات SOAP و WCF را در ابتدا کشف خواهید کرد. سپس ، شما یک REST API را کاوش خواهید کرد و خواهید دید که چگونه می توان از Xamarin.Forms به این مورد دسترسی پیدا کرد. سرانجام ، شما می فهمید که چگونه می توان ارتباطات سرویس را در Xamarin ایجاد کرد. با استفاده از دوباره امتحان کردن و مدیریت خطا ، برنامه ها از انعطاف پذیری بیشتری برخوردار هستند. پس از اتمام این دوره ، شما درک خوبی از چگونگی Xamarin.Forms برنامه های شما می تواند با خدمات برای دسترسی به داده های به روز متصل شود.

سرفصل ها و درس ها

بررسی اجمالی دوره Course Overview

  • بررسی اجمالی دوره Course Overview

درک مفاهیم کار با داده های از راه دور در Xamarin.Forms Understanding the Concepts of Working with Remote Data in Xamarin.Forms

  • معرفی ماژول Module Introduction

  • آنچه از این دوره خواهید آموخت What You'll Learn from This Course

  • با نگاهی به برنامه تمام شده Looking at the Finished Application

  • نسخه ی نمایشی: نگاهی به برنامه تمام شده Demo: Looking at the Finished Application

  • کار با سرویس ها Working with Services

  • ابزارهای مورد نیاز Required Tools

  • نسخه ی نمایشی: آماده سازی ماشین Demo: Getting Your Machine Ready

کار با انواع سرویس های سنتی از Xamarin.Forms Working with Traditional Service Types from Xamarin.Forms

  • معرفی ماژول Module Introduction

  • کاوش خدمات ASMX Exploring ASMX Services

  • نسخه ی نمایشی: بررسی سرویس ASMX Demo: Exploring an ASMX Service

  • اتصال با خدمات ASMX Connecting with ASMX Services

  • نسخه ی نمایشی: اتصال با خدمات ASMX Demo: Connecting with ASMX Services

  • کاوش خدمات WCF Exploring WCF Services

  • نسخه ی نمایشی: بررسی سرویس WCF Demo: Exploring a WCF Service

  • اتصال با خدمات WCF Connecting with WCF Services

  • نسخه ی نمایشی: اتصال با خدمات WCF Demo: Connecting with WCF Services

  • خلاصه Summary

دسترسی به داده های پشت سرویس REST Accessing Data behind a REST Service

  • معرفی ماژول Module Introduction

  • REST چیست؟ What Is REST?

  • نسخه ی نمایشی: بررسی سرویس REST ساخته شده با ASP.NET Core 3.1 Demo: Exploring a REST Service Built with ASP.NET Core 3.1

  • نسخه ی نمایشی: استفاده از پستچی برای ارتباط با سرویس REST Demo: Using Postman to Connect with a REST Service

  • برقراری ارتباط از Xamarin.Forms با REST Services Communicating from Xamarin.Forms with REST Services

  • نسخه ی نمایشی: اتصال با سرویس REST Demo: Connecting with the REST Service

  • سایر عملیات API Other API Operations

  • نسخه ی نمایشی: افزودن ، به روزرسانی و حذف داده ها Demo: Adding, Updating, and Deleting Data

  • نسخه ی نمایشی: اتصال با API محلی میزبان Demo: Connecting with a Locally-hosted API

  • پیکربندی ارتباطات برای Android و iOS Configuring the Communication for Android and iOS

  • نسخه ی نمایشی: پیکربندی ارتباطات برای Android و iOS Demo: Configuring the Communication for Android and iOS

  • خلاصه Summary

مفاهیم پیشرفته در مورد کار با خدمات REST Advanced Concepts around Working with REST Services

  • معرفی ماژول Module Introduction

  • انعطاف پذیری بیشتر سرویس Making the Service More Resilient

  • نسخه ی نمایشی: افزودن Polly Demo: Adding Polly

  • افزودن حافظه پنهان Adding Caching

  • نسخه ی نمایشی: افزودن حافظه پنهان با استفاده از Akavache Demo: Adding Caching Using Akavache

  • نسخه ی نمایشی: مدیریت خطاها Demo: Handling Errors

  • در دسترس بودن شبکه را بررسی کنید Checking Network Availability

  • نسخه ی نمایشی: بررسی در دسترس بودن شبکه Demo: Checking Network Availability

  • خلاصه و اختتامیه دوره Summary and Course Closing

نمایش نظرات

آموزش کار با داده های از راه دور در Xamarin.Forms برنامه های کاربردی
جزییات دوره
2h 9m
39
Pluralsight (پلورال سایت) Pluralsight (پلورال سایت)
(آخرین آپدیت)
18
4.9 از 5
دارد
دارد
دارد
Gill Cleeren
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Gill Cleeren Gill Cleeren

گیل کلیرن مدیر منطقه ای مایکروسافت ، نویسنده MVP و Pluralsight است. گیل یک معمار مستقل راه حل است که در بلژیک زندگی می کند. او روی توسعه وب و موبایل تمرکز دارد و عاشق Xamarin است. وی همچنین سخنران مکرر بسیاری از کنفرانس های بین المللی است. گیل همچنین بزرگترین کنفرانس IT در بلژیک و هلند را Techorama تأسیس کرد. می توانید وب سایت وی را به آدرس www.snowball.be بیابید.